I'm not sure where the company has this info for you to find, but I'm happy to print it here.
Personally, I think they're smart to encourage more senior (i.e. more expensive) F/As to leave, but I don't know that travel benefits alone are enough to nudge many of them out the door.
- 65 Point Plan: Years of service + age add up to at least 65. Unlimited on/offline travel at S4 status (inactive) and a travel card. Four companion passes and two SA1 vacation passes as long as the company awards them.
- 25/45: 25 years of service as a F/A and you're at least 45 years old you can resign and get unlimited on/offline passes at S3 boarding status (active) and a travel card. Eight companion passes and two SA1 passes.
- Retirement: Must be at least 55 and have 5 yrs. of service. Unlimited on/offline travel on S4 status. Four companion passes and two SA1 passes.
- Retirement with 25/45 Privileges: Must be at least 55 and have at least 25 yrs. of service as a F/A and you get the same travel privileges as the 25/45 plan.
